From source file:MainActivity.java

private File getPictureFile() {
    String timeStamp = new SimpleDateFormat("yyyyMMdd_HHmmss").format(System.currentTimeMillis());
    String fileName = "PHOTO_" + timeStamp + ".jpg";
    return new File(Environment.getExternalStoragePublicDirectory(Environment.DIRECTORY_PICTURES), fileName);
}

From source file:com.xengar.android.booksearch.ui.BookDetailActivity.java

public Uri getLocalBitmapUri(ImageView imageView) {
    // Extract Bitmap from ImageView drawable
    Drawable drawable = imageView.getDrawable();
    Bitmap bmp = null;//  w w  w .j  av  a 2  s.  c om
    if (drawable instanceof BitmapDrawable) {
        bmp = ((BitmapDrawable) imageView.getDrawable()).getBitmap();
    } else {
        return null;
    }
    // Store image to default external storage directory
    Uri bmpUri = null;
    try {
        File file = new File(getExternalFilesDir(Environment.DIRECTORY_PICTURES),
                "share_image_" + System.currentTimeMillis() + ".png");
        file.getParentFile().mkdirs();
        FileOutputStream out = new FileOutputStream(file);
        bmp.compress(Bitmap.CompressFormat.PNG, 90, out);
        out.close();
        bmpUri = Uri.fromFile(file);
    } catch (IOException e) {
        e.printStackTrace();
    }
    return bmpUri;
}

From source file:me.piebridge.prevent.ui.UserGuideActivity.java

private File getQrCode() {
    File dir = Environment.getExternalStoragePublicDirectory(Environment.DIRECTORY_PICTURES);
    if (dir == null) {
        return null;
    }//from w w  w.j a v  a 2s .  c  o  m
    if (!checkPermission()) {
        return null;
    }
    File screenshots = new File(dir, "Screenshots");
    if (!screenshots.exists()) {
        screenshots.mkdirs();
    }
    return new File(screenshots, "pr_donate.png");
}
